Why are One Tree Hill quotes so popular?
The enduring popularity of One Tree Hill quotes stems from their relatability. The show tackled universal themes like friendship, love, loss, ambition, and self-discovery with honesty and vulnerability. The characters, despite their flaws, felt authentic, making their struggles and triumphs relatable to viewers. The quotes themselves are often poetic, insightful, and beautifully encapsulate the emotional rollercoaster of life. They offer comfort, inspiration, and a sense of shared experience, resonating with audiences long after the final episode aired.
